Types of Wiring Diagrams



When it comes to wiring diagrams, there are essentially two types: schematic diagrams and block diagrams. Schematic diagrams are designed to visually represent the flow of electricity through various components. They feature an intuitive design that makes it easy to identify what’s connected to what. Block diagrams, on the other hand, are designed to show the overall operation of a system. They feature larger components that are connected with arrows that point in the direction of information flow.

The wiring diagram for your LCD panel will most likely be a schematic diagram. This is because LCD panels are simple devices that don’t require a lot of complex circuitry. As such, a schematic diagram is the best way to illustrate the connections.

Setting Up Your LCD Panel



Once you’ve familiarized yourself with the wiring diagrams for your LCD panel, it’s time to get started. The process is fairly straightforward—all you need to do is connect the appropriate wires to the correct pins.

Before you start, make sure you have the right tools. You’ll need a soldering iron, solder, and wire cutters in order to make the connections. In addition, make sure you have enough wire to reach all the necessary pins.

Once you’ve gathered your tools and materials, begin by connecting the power wires. These will be the red and black wires, and they should be connected to the power pins on the LCD panel. Next, connect the ground wire to the ground pins. Finally, connect the data wires to the remaining pins.

Once you’ve made all the necessary connections, turn on the power and test the LCD panel. If everything is working correctly, you’re done!
